What is drug regulation in the modern pharmaceutical landscape? Drug regulation represents a comprehensive system of controls, standards, and oversight mechanisms designed to ensure that medications reaching American consumers are both safe and effective. This regulatory framework extends far beyond simple quality control-it encompasses every stage from initial drug discovery through post-market surveillance, creating multiple safety nets that protect public health.
The regulatory process involves rigorous scientific evaluation, clinical testing protocols, manufacturing standards, and ongoing monitoring systems. In the United States, the Food and Drug Administration (FDA) serves as the primary regulatory body, wielding authority to approve, reject, or withdraw medications based on scientific evidence and risk assessments.
The modern drug regulation system emerged from devastating public health crises that exposed dangerous gaps in pharmaceutical oversight. The 1937 Elixir Sulfanilamide tragedy stands as a watershed moment in American regulatory history. A Tennessee pharmaceutical company created a liquid formulation of sulfanilamide using diethylene glycol-a toxic compound also found in antifreeze-as a solvent. This sweet-tasting "medicine" killed 107 people, including many children, within months of its release.
This disaster directly led to the passage of the Food, Drug, and Cosmetic Act of 1938, which fundamentally transformed pharmaceutical regulation by requiring manufacturers to demonstrate drug safety before marketing. However, this legislation still didn't address efficacy-drugs only needed to be safe, not necessarily effective.
The thalidomide crisis of the early 1960s further revolutionized drug regulation. While this sedative caused severe birth defects in thousands of babies worldwide, the United States largely avoided this tragedy due to FDA scientist Frances Kelsey's refusal to approve the drug. Nevertheless, the crisis prompted Congress to pass the Kefauver-Harris Amendments in 1962, which mandated that manufacturers prove both safety AND efficacy before drug approval.
Today's drug regulation system operates through a structured pathway that includes preclinical research, Investigational New Drug (IND) applications, and phased clinical trials. Students preparing for the MCAT or pharmacy school admissions should understand that this process typically takes 10-15 years and costs hundreds of millions of dollars per approved medication.
The IND application represents a critical milestone where pharmaceutical companies submit preclinical data-including animal testing results-to the FDA before beginning human trials. This requirement ensures that potential treatments demonstrate reasonable safety profiles in laboratory settings before exposing human volunteers to experimental drugs.
Risk-benefit analysis has become central to modern drug regulation, appearing frequently on AP Biology exams and college pharmacology courses. Regulatory agencies must weigh a drug's potential therapeutic benefits against its known risks, considering factors like disease severity, available alternatives, and patient population characteristics.
